Mint Three.js Skills

Mint's agent skill suite for browser-based Three.js work. It combines and adapts open source Three.js game, application, and graphics-agent workflows, generalized for 3D apps while retaining deep game workflows.

Choose A Route

  • Fresh request whose primary deliverable is one generated model, an animated

model, a coherent model asset pack, one material, a material pack, or one explicitly requested Mint world: read references/asset-viewer.md, then use the app director. The asset is the product; the viewer is its inspection and download shell.

  • General 3D app, viewer, configurator, simulation, walkthrough, editor, or

interactive experience: read skills/threejs-app-director/SKILL.md.

  • Game or game-like request with objectives, challenge, scoring, failure,

progression, or game feel: read skills/threejs-game-director/SKILL.md.

  • Mixed experience: start with the app director, then add only the relevant game

specialists.

Both routes share visual systems, interaction, debugging, QA, and references/mint-mcp-assets.md. Projects that use Mint assets also use the durable registry in references/asset-pipeline.md.

Existing app or game context wins over asset delivery. Generate and integrate a requested asset into that project instead of scaffolding a separate viewer.

Invariants

  • Existing project architecture wins. For greenfield work, default to

TypeScript, Vite, and Three.js modules.

  • Vanilla Three.js is the default; support React Three Fiber or another

Three.js-based stack when the project or user chooses it.

  • Mint MCP is the only generated-asset production pipeline. Keep MCP calls out

of browser runtime code.

  • For every project that imports Mint files or remote world configuration,

maintain a project-root mint-assets.json through scripts/sync-mint-assets.mjs. Reuse stable logical keys and preserve the existing project's asset-root conventions.

  • For every Three.js path that loads Mint-generated GLBs, read

references/gltf-runtime-compatibility.md and use a Draco-capable shared loader. Mint-optimized GLBs are not compatible with a bare GLTFLoader.

  • Prefer discrete generated models and compose them in Three.js. Generate a

Mint world only when the user explicitly chooses a generated environment; then read references/mint-world-splats.md.

  • Use procedural or user-provided assets when they are the right design choice

or Mint MCP lacks the required capability. Never create a competing procedural version of a subject that Mint generated successfully.

  • Before verification, read references/verification-policy.md. Run its

automatic minimum, ask before extended desktop/browser QA, and require a separate secondary approval for mobile QA. Its approval boundary overrides broader specialist completion gates.

  • Do not force game concepts such as objectives, pressure, rewards, or failure

onto general 3D apps.

User-Owned UI

  • Treat the delivered app as the user's product, not as a demo of the

asset-generation pipeline.

  • Keep provider names, branding, badges, generation links, asset IDs, and

provenance out of runtime UI unless the user explicitly asks for them.

  • Mention generation provenance and handoff links only in the final response or

developer documentation.

  • Default to the minimum UI required for the experience: loading and error

status, essential controls, and explicitly requested actions.

  • Do not add headers, title bars, navigation, marketing copy, attribution, or

decorative application chrome unless requested.

  • For the canonical asset viewer, keep the canvas dominant with a compact

centered details dialog opened from an info button plus bottom-centered inspection controls. Do not reserve permanent sidebar space. For other simple viewers and walkthroughs, use a compact bottom-centered control group. Place loading, ready, or error status directly above it using the same compact visual language.

When the user asks for a reusable prompt, use references/request-templates.md.
